Answer:
the ratio of Jan's average walking rate to Bev's average walking rate is 3/4 or 3 : 4
Step-by-step explanation:
Let x and y represent jan and Bev's average walk rate.
Also t represent the time taken for Bev to walk 4 miles, so it will take jan 2t time to walk 6 miles
Given that;
It takes Jan twice as many hours to walk 6 miles as it takes Bev to walk 4 miles
For Bev;
y = 4/t
For Jan;
x = 6/(2t) = 3/t
the ratio of Jan's average walking rate to Bev's average walking rate is;
x/y = (3/t)/(4/t) = 3/4
the ratio of Jan's average walking rate to Bev's average walking rate is 3/4 or 3 : 4
